Ingredients

  • All purpose flour: gives the donut body and structure. Choose unbleached for a softer crumb.
  • Granulated sugar: sweetens the batter and the strawberries. Always use fresh sugar for best flavor.
  • Baking powder: helps the donuts rise and keeps them fluffy. Look for an expiration date less than six months old.
  • Salt: enhances every other flavor in the recipe. Use fine sea salt for even distribution.
  • Milk: adds moisture and tenderness. Whole milk works best for richness.
  • Large eggs: provide structure and help bind the batter. Pick fresh eggs with firm whites for best results.
  • Unsalted butter: brings buttery notes without oversalting. Melt gently and let cool slightly before mixing.
  • Vanilla extract: gives warmth to both donut and filling. Go for pure vanilla for deeper flavor.
  • Cream cheese: brings the tangy signature cheesecake taste. Softening at room temperature is key for a smooth filling.
  • Powdered sugar: sweetens both the filling and glaze. Sift for a lump free finish.
  • Fresh strawberries: create the bright flavor in the glaze. Choose berries that are deep red and fragrant.
  • Lemon juice: adds subtle tartness to balance sweetness. Freshly squeezed delivers best brightness.

Instructions

Preheat the Oven:
Set your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. This ensures even heat so the donuts bake up fluffy and golden.
Mix Dry Ingredients:
In a large mixing bowl whisk together the flour granulated sugar baking powder and salt. Mixing well ensures every donut will rise evenly and have balanced sweetness.
Mix Wet Ingredients:
In a separate bowl combine the milk eggs melted and slightly cooled butter and vanilla. Beat until smooth. A level batter here makes for consistent donut texture.
Combine Wet and Dry:
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ients. Stir just enough to combine. Avoid overmixing or the donuts could get tough.
Fill Donut Pans:
Spoon or pipe the batter into greased donut pans filling each cavity about three quarters full. This lets the donuts puff up but not spill over.
Bake and Cool:
Bake for ten to twelve minutes. Check with a gentle poke the donut should spring back when ready. Let cool completely to avoid melting the filling.
Make Cheesecake Filling:
With an electric mixer beat cream cheese powdered sugar and vanilla until the mixture is silky. No lumps should remain for a true cheesecake experience.
Prepare the Cheesecake Filling Bag:
Transfer the creamy filling to a piping bag fitted with a small tip. This step ensures you can neatly fill the donuts without overfilling or mess.
Cook Strawberry Glaze:
In a small saucepan cook chopped strawberries granulated sugar and lemon juice over medium heat for five to seven minutes. Stir occasionally and mash slightly to help the berries break down.
Glaze Consistency:
Allow the strawberry mixture to cool before whisking in powdered sugar. This turns the berries into a thick glossy glaze that will coat the donuts perfectly.
Fill the Donuts:
Push the piping tip into the side or bottom of each cooled donut. Squeeze gently to fill with cheesecake mixture until you feel the donut swell slightly.
Dip and Set:
Dip the tops of the filled donuts into the strawberry glaze. Let the excess drip off and allow the glaze to set before serving for the prettiest finish.

Storage Tips

Once filled and glazed store the donuts in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. The glaze may become a bit sticky over time but flavor stays vibrant. Let them sit at room temperature for fifteen minutes before serving.

Ingredient Substitutions

You can use whole wheat pastry flour in place of all purpose for a heartier texture. If strawberries are not in season try raspberries or blueberries for the glaze. Greek yogurt can be swapped for cream cheese for a tangy lighter filling.

Freezer Meal Conversion

Bake the donuts as directed and cool completely. Do not fill or glaze yet. Store in an airtight freezer container for up to two months. Thaw overnight at room temperature then add the filling and glaze just before serving for best results.

Recipe FAQs

→ Can I use frozen strawberries for the glaze?

Yes, frozen strawberries work well. Thaw them first and drain excess liquid before cooking.

→ How do I store the donuts after baking?

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days to maintain freshness.

→ Is it possible to prepare the filling ahead of time?

Yes, the cheesecake filling can be made in advance and kept refrigerated until ready to use.

→ Can these donuts be made gluten-free?

Yes, substitute the all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free baking blend for similar results.

→ What’s the best way to fill the donuts?

Use a piping bag with a small tip to inject the cream cheese mixture through the side or bottom of the donuts.

Ingredients

→ Donut Base

01 2 cups all-purpose flour
02 1/2 cup granulated sugar
03 2 teaspoons baking powder
04 1/2 teaspoon salt
05 3/4 cup whole milk
06 2 large eggs
07 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
08 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

→ Cheesecake Filling

09 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
10 1/4 cup powdered sugar
11 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

→ Strawberry Glaze

12 1 cup fresh strawberries, chopped
13 1/4 cup granulated sugar
14 1 teaspoon lemon juice
15 1 cup powdered sugar

Steps

Step 01

Set oven to 350°F (175°C) and ensure racks are positioned in the center.

Step 02

In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t.

Step 03

In a separate bowl, whisk together milk, eggs, melted unsalted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th.

Step 04

Add wet mixture to dry ingredients. Stir just until combined, avoiding overmixing to maintain tenderness.

Step 05

Spoon batter into greased donut pans, filling each cavity about three-quarters full.

Step 06

Bake for 10 to 12 minutes, or until donuts spring back lightly when touched. Allow to cool completely in pans before removing.

Step 07

Beat softened cream cheese,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ract together until the mixture is smooth and creamy.

Step 08

Transfer cheesecake mixture to a piping bag fitted with a small tip for injecting the filling.

Step 09

In a small saucepan, combine chopped strawberries, granulated sugar, and lemon juice. Cook over medium heat for 5 to 7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until strawberries soften. Lightly mash the mixture.

Step 10

Allow strawberry mixture to cool, then combine with powdered sugar and mix until a thick glaze forms.

Step 11

Insert piping tip into the side or bottom of each cooled donut and fill with cheesecake mixture.

Step 12

Dip the top of each filled donut into the strawberry glaze, ensuring full surface coverage.

Step 13

Place glazed donuts on a wire rack and allow glaze to set completely before serving.

Notes

  1. For best results, ensure donuts are fully cooled before filling to prevent the cheesecake mixture from melting.
